VANC data recording/playback

VANC data recording

1 Detects the VANC data packets that multiplex recorded in the following range of the Y stream of HD SDI.

1080i: L9–L20, L571–L583

720P: L9–L25

<Note>

HANC data packets are not be detected.

2 Records VANC data packets up to the following volume in the VAUX region of the DVCPRO HD format in the order of the earlier line.

1080i: 5760 word/frame

720P: 2880 word/frame

<Note>

Data packets that exceed the capacity will not be recorded or played back.

3 Records the video signal from the HD SDI simultaneously.

<Note>

Recording and playback of VANC data only are not possible.

VANC data playback

1 If the VTR mode is one of the following, VANC data will be multiplexed to the Y stream of the HD SDI and will be played back with the video signal.

zNormal playback mode

zSimultaneous playback mode

zEdit playback mode

zEE mode

<Notes>

zIf an operation mode other than the above, such as FF, REW, JOG, VAR, the video signal will only be played back by muting VANC data.

zPlayback of VANC data only is not possible.

2 VANC data packets will be multiplexed to the same line of the multiplex line.

<Notes>

zFor format conversion playback, the video signal only will be played back by muting VANC data.

zMetadata recorded on the tape will be output giving UMID information first priority. When metadata is output, set to a line other than the original multiplexed line or select “BLANK.”
